C/S hired an independent engineering firm to model the energy and capital cost savings that an owner would achieve by using C/S Controllable Sunshades on a ten story building in Dallas and four other cities throughout the U.S. and Canada. The test building’s facade includes standard double glazed low-E glass on all elevations. The results of the computer 
model in the chart above show the energy usage/savings with and without C/S Controllable 
Sunshades. The engineering firm utilized a recognized building modeling program.

The C/S external controllable solar shading system substantially reduces both the capital cost of plant and the associated running costs for air conditioning. A 21.1% reduction in the annual cooling energy demand (MWhrs) is achieved which translates into a savings of $137,160 per annum.
